General Info
In Block
e4c824c3cbaa7df70c7386c0dc8d58ddbb10f46f223a4c6884cef0ad8a90d408
In block height
Total Input
2597961.19800956 RDD
Total Output
2598353.4818476 RDD
Transaction Details
Fee
0 RDD
mined Sat, 19 Aug 2017 23:03:30 UTC
From
1299079.17608225 RDDFrom
1298882.02192731 RDD